A character drama based on the 2001 Elmore Leonard short story "Fire in the Hole." Leonard's tale centers around U.S. Marshal Raylan Givens of Kentucky, a quiet but strong-willed official of the law. The tale covers his high-stakes job, as well as his strained relationships with his ex-wife and father.

Justified - S3E2

#13 - Cut Ties (Staffel 3 - Folge 2)

The murder of a fellow marshal throws Raylan together with a former female colleague, and Art leaves the office to track down another angle of the case. Meanwhile, Boyd engineers a showdown with Dickie Bennett, despite Raylan's effort to prevent it.

Justified - S3E13

#1 - Slaughterhouse (Staffel 3 - Folge 13)

In the episode "Slaughterhouse" of the TV show Justified, Raylan is consumed by anger and seeks vengeance after the murder of his friend. With a burning desire for justice, he sets out on a relentless mission to hold everyone accountable for their actions, leading to a violent and intense final confrontation.

Viewers were left emotionally shaken by the shocking turn of events. One commenter expressed their heartbreak, saying that they cried when the Trooper was shot, but the revelation that Arlo had witnessed the crime made the situation even more devastating. Raylan had been unaware of this heartbreaking truth, adding another layer of pain to an already difficult situation.
